Nice manager, Patrick Vieira has confirmed that Nice are interested in the French striker joining Nice in the summer.

Nice have confirmed they have an interest in French forward Olivier Giroud. 

The French club are looking to sign Giroud from Chelsea this summer, as his contract will end at the end of the season. 

Giroud was originally looking likely to leave Chelsea before Sarri confirmed he would be triggering the one year contract extension in Giroud's contract.

Giroud has not been a regular starter this season under Sarri, only featuring in the Europa League since Gonzalo Higuain arrived in January.

The French World Cup winner began his career in France, where he won the league with Montpellier in the 2011/12 season, and Vieira is looking to bring him back to Ligue 1 this summer. Nice's technical director confirmed these rumours when he said:

 'If Olivier Giroud decides to come that is because he likes the project at OGC Nice, If Olivier is not happy at Chelsea, if he wants to play, we will take all the elements into account. I have spoken with Patrick [Vieira] about Olivier Giroud, but we have not spoken with Olivier Giroud.'
